Welcome to Odyssians Camp
We organise a week-long fun-packed camping adventure holiday for disabled adults aged 18 to 35, every year since 1994. We have no paid staff, so we are looking for volunteer helpers of any age who can help us take care of our disabled campers' needs (like eating and dressing) as well as help us have fun (like swimming or riding specially adapted bicycles) next August. It's hard work, but you don't need any experience: we'll partner you with an experienced helper who can help you learn how to do it.
If you have a physical disability and you are aged 18 to 35, why not have a look around to see if you would like to join us too?

You also made lots of suggestions about things we can do better.
Lots of you thought some people worked much harder than others. To help this, next year we'll keep a closer eye on who's putting in less effort and be more consistent about asking them to do a little more - this will help us arrange cover if you need to go to bed earlier some nights too.
You also asked for more training, so we'll arrange more formal training sessions for the first day. This also means we'll be more strict: if you have care needs, you will not be able to arrive before 5pm unless you have arranged an earlier start in advance. This will help us concentrate on training our volunteer helpers for the first couple of hours, and in turn means we'll have a better handover when you do arrive.
Finally, you told us you liked the swimming better when there were fewer people in the pool, so we'll be splitting our camp into smaller groups for swimming this year.
You made some great suggestions for themes and activities too: the most popular was "wild west", so that will be the theme for our Friday night fancy dress party. See you there!
